Full Metadata Cache Support
Advanced Canvas enables .canvas files to be indexed by the metadata cache. This means that there is now full compatibility with the graph view, outgoing links and backlinks. You can even enable (optional) the creation of an outgoing link if two embeds in a canvas are connected by an edge. This feature brings the full power of Obsidian's linking system to the canvas file format.

Technical Details
- The file cache of a .canvas file now contains a value for the hash key (Generated from the filepath) instead of an empty string
- Check the
app.metadataCache.fileCache[<filepath>]object to see the changes
- Check the
- The metadata cache is located in the
app.metadataCacheobject - the same object that is used by Obsidian for markdown files- e.g.
app.metadataCache.getCache/app.metadataCache.getFileCachenow works with .canvas files - The
positionobject which is found inside metadata cache entries now contains a new keynodeIdfor .canvas files - The metadata cache entry for a .canvas file now contains a new key
nodeswhich is an object of type{ [nodeId: string]: MetadataCacheEntry }- this allows for other plugins to access the full metadata cache for single nodes. TheMetadataCacheEntryobject is the same as for markdown files (even created with the same function - 1:1 compatibility)
- e.g.
- The resolved links object now has entries for .canvas files
- The
app.metadataCache.resolvedLinksobject values for .canvas files are implemented in the exact same way as for markdown files

Custom Styles
Custom style attributes for nodes and edges can easily be added.
- Create a new CSS snippet in your vault
- To do this, navigate to
Settings > Appearance > *scroll down* > CSS snippetsand click on the folder icon to open the snippets folder - Create a new CSS file (e.g.
my-fancy-node-style.css)
- To do this, navigate to
- Add the custom style attribute
- Open the CSS file and add the following code and replace the values how you like. The format needs to be YAML and needs to contain the same keys as in this example. The amount of options can be adjusted as needed (minimum of one option is required). The
iconkey should contain the id of the icon you want to use. You can find the icons on lucide.dev - Change the
@advanced-canvas-node-styleto@advanced-canvas-edge-styleif you want to add a custom style attribute for edges
/* @advanced-canvas-node-style key: validation-state label: Validation State options: - label: Stateless value: null icon: circle-help - label: Approved value: approved icon: circle-check - label: Pending value: pending icon: circle-dot - label: Rejected value: rejected icon: circle-x */ - Open the CSS file and add the following code and replace the values how you like. The format needs to be YAML and needs to contain the same keys as in this example. The amount of options can be adjusted as needed (minimum of one option is required). The
Important
There needs to be one option with the value null
- Add the CSS styling
- In the same (or another) CSS file, add the styling for the custom style attribute
in my case:.canvas-node[data-<YOUR-CUSTOM-STYLE-KEY>="<VALUE>"] { /* Your custom styling */ }.canvas-node[data-validation-state] .canvas-node-content::after { content: ""; position: absolute; top: 10px; right: 10px; font-size: 1em; } .canvas-node[data-validation-state="approved"] .canvas-node-content::after { content: "✔️"; } .canvas-node[data-validation-state="pending"] .canvas-node-content::after { content: "⏳"; } .canvas-node[data-validation-state="rejected"] .canvas-node-content::after { content: "❌"; } - Enable the CSS snippet in the settings and enjoy your new custom style attribute!

Variable Breakpoints
Add breakpoints to nodes to change at which zoom factor the node's content gets unrendered.
Important
Due to performance reasons, custom breakpoints get cached and are only re-fetched when the canvas gets reloaded. This means that changes in the CSS snippet won't be applied immediately (Only after a reopening of the canvas).
Create a new CSS snippet in your vault (And enable it in the settings)
/* Any CSS selector can be used (As long as the .canvas-node element has the CSS variable defined) */
.canvas-node[data-shape="pill"] {
/* The zoom factor at which the node's content gets unrendered (Zoom level can reach from 1 to -4) */
--variable-breakpoint: 0.5;
}

Custom Colors
Add custom colors to the color picker. You can add them using the following css snippet:
body {
/* Where X is the index of the color in the palette */
/* The colors 1-6 are already used by Obsidian */
--canvas-color-X: 0, 255, 0; /* RGB */
}

Presentation Mode
In presentation mode, you can navigate through the nodes using the arrow keys or the PageUp/PageDown keys (Compatible with most presentation remotes). The different slides/nodes are connected using arrows. If you want to have multiple arrows pointing from the same node, you can number them in the order you want to navigate through them. While in presentation mode, the canvas is in readonly mode (So better readonly effects the presentation mode as well!). You can exit the presentation mode using the ESC key or the corresponding command. If you want to continue the presentation from the last slide you were on, you can use the Advanced Canvas: Continue presentation command.

Canvas Events
All custom events are prefixed with advanced-canvas: and can be listened to using app.workspace.on (Just like the default events).
